It’s A Win(e)-Win! Drink Wine For A Good Cause!

Where can you enjoy samples of aromatic wines from around the world while helping college students raise scholarship funds? At St. Ambrose University’s Wine Festival, of course! The St. Ambrose Wine Festival has successfully raised more than one million dollars for student scholarships throughout its fifteen-year history. There is a trio of events to help raise these funds, and the annual Wine Tasting night is upon us! Looking for a fun and healthy way to get your kids involved in the kitchen? It’s no secret that including your children in meal planning and preparation builds healthier eating habits. It can, however, be difficult to know where to start. Hy-Vee food stores are hoping to help take some of the guess work out of how to involve the kids, with their ‘Kids in the Kitchen’ programs. These fun and educational kids’ cooking classes are held monthly at your local Hy-Vee stores for children ages 4-9.
